This is a recorded webinar from July 18, 2023.

Concrete is unique among building materials. Its formulation is highly influenced by its application. Design professionals and contractors have a greater influence on concrete formulation than they do with other building products. Concrete can be made stronger, lighter, more flowable, stiffer, less permeable, and even weaker depending on performance needs. No other building material is that versatile. This presentation will discuss how design and construction teams can implement ten simple strategies to reduce concrete’s carbon footprint today. The recommendations are listed broadly in order of priority, but not in order of impact reduction. All are important and should be implemented. In addition, the strategies are meant to achieve a lower carbon footprint without impacting other desired performance capabilities for the concrete.

Learning Objectives:

1. Understand the basics of embodied carbon of concrete.

2. Evaluate the immediate steps that can be taken to reduce carbon footprint when specifying concrete.

3. Prioritize design strategies to get the greatest reductions in carbon footprint using current technologies and design tools.

4. Explore how innovative technologies will result in zero carbon concrete in the future.
